There have been a few topics on here which have suggested it may be security programs (such as Norton and VPN) which may be causing the VM FSB50 errors.
Have you tried (by way of a test) disabling Norton and VPN while trying to access the 'My VM' website?
I have worked on quite a lot of computers for friends and family over the years and invariably, IMHO, Norton seems to do more harm than good. It is not a product I would ever install on my own equipment.
Is there a particular reason you are using a VPN for routine web browsing? That too may cause complications accessing some sites.
